Output 41a6d590df64c5afe14b7b9f57f1ec31424a659e7fb289a3ee44dc2a1c68904a:0

value
740689
script pubkey
OP_0 OP_PUSHBYTES_20 3859f05992954f3c32ab986ae06917df84f8bcb3
address
bc1q8pvlqkvjj48ncv4tnp4wq6ghm7z0309ng4kkeg
transaction
41a6d590df64c5afe14b7b9f57f1ec31424a659e7fb289a3ee44dc2a1c68904a
spent
true